Abstract
Temperature dependence of anisotropic tensor susceptibility (ATS) scattering intensities of GdB4 were measured near L-edges of Gd to investigate how spin ordering affects ATS. ATS scattering intensities for L2- and L3-edges show different temperature dependence below TN. At L3-edge the intensities reflect spin order parameter while intensities at L2-edge do not show noticeable change. The difference is explained in terms of spin-orbit coupling and isotropic distribution of spin-polarized 5d states of Gd ions. Above TN ATS scattering intensities demonstrate that thermal motions enhance charge distribution anisotorpy of Gd 5d states in paramagnetic phase.
